Public defenders are experienced attorneys who represent low-income individuals and defendants unable to afford legal representation. According to the National Association for Public Defense, every year in the US, over 50,000 public defenders work tirelessly behind the scenes to assist approximately 15 million individuals.
How it Works: A Beginner's Guide to Public Defenders in Queens
Public defenders often appear in all stages of a court case, from arraignment to trial. Typically, they start working on behalf of a defendant well before the trial, leaving no stone unturned as they prepare a robust defense.
